Late Kedari Redekar Ayurvedic Mahavidyalaya is a good college. Late Kedari Redekar Ayurvedic Mahavidyalaya is approved by CCIM/NCISM and Ayush New Delhi & Govt. of Maharashtra. The college is affiliated with the MUHS Nashik

Students have to submit some documents during Late Kedari Redekar Ayurvedic Mahavidyalaya admissions and applications. The general list is as below:

  • Four copies of Class 10 marksheet & Certificate
  • Four copies of Class 12 marksheet & Certificate
  • Four copies of BAMS degree marksheet & Certificate - for PG courses
  • Internship completion Certificate after BAMS - for PG courses
  • MCIM Registration Certificate - for PG courses
  • Medical Fitness Certificate
  • Four copies of Nationality Certificate 
  • NEET UG markshseet 
  • Selection Letter - CET Cell 
  • Four copies of NEET Online Registration from State Quota
  • Four copies of NEET Admit Card

Late Kedari Redekar Ayurvedic Mahavidyalaya fee has to be paid timely. It contains different components. The amount may change depending on the student's gender, category, and more. The fees is as below:

CourseTotal Tuition Fees
BAMSINR 10.1 lakh
MD/ MSINR 5.4 lakh
